The 3-Hour Work Cycle

From 9am to noon, children work without interruption on materials they choose. No bells. No forced transitions. This is where deep concentration — one of Montessori's rarest gifts — actually develops.

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S)

This UK framework covers 7 areas of learning: Communication, Physical Development, Personal & Social Development, Literacy, Maths, Understanding the World, and Expressive Arts. Lata has used this framework at DFW Montessori schools for over a decade.

Daily Life

A typical day in the Preschool room

The 3-hour work cycle is the centrepiece. Everything else is built around it — so children get the deep, uninterrupted time that real learning requires.

Times are consistent from day to day — predictability is part of the Montessori method.

6:30am – Arrival & Morning Work

Children arrive and begin self-directed work at the shelves. Early arrivals get extended work time — a natural incentive for punctuality.

9:00am – 12:00pm — The Work Cycle

Three uninterrupted hours. Children choose from Montessori materials across all curriculum areas — practical life, sensorial, language, maths, culture. Guides observe and give individual lessons. No group interruptions.

12:00pm – Lunch & Outdoor Play

Children prepare their place settings, eat together, and help clean up. Outdoor time follows — physical movement, social play, and a natural break before the afternoon.

Afternoon – Group Work & Rest

Circle time, stories, art, and group lessons. Rest period for those who need it. EYFS and TEKS-aligned activities woven through the afternoon for children who are ready.

Up to 6:30pm – Pickup

Free afternoon work until pickup. Your guide shares what your child worked on, any new concepts introduced, and highlights from the day.
